Drums-percussion Each section of this department has different admission and examination criteria and the content of the course is modified accordingly.
The study content includes specific practical training in the chosen instruments, ensemble work and learning of repertoire.
The aims of the course are the following:
• achievement of highest technical perfection, clarity and virtuosity as the foundation of optimal individual musical expression
• obtaining a working knowledge of different styles and skill in sightreading
• developing own arrangements and playing styles
• functional and communicative empathy – interaction
• encouraging the student’s awareness of the need to take responsibility for his/her own musical development in order to participate fully as a musical personality.

Courses
Subjects for Drummers
• technique, independence and coordination of different levels
• basics of different styles, their development and creative application
• phrasing and interpretation
• sightreading in different styles
• Bigband drumming
In addition, ensemble and rhythm group work plus supervision in appropriate
bands, e.g. Latin / Brazil / Afro, Bigband, drum ensembles, etc…
Subjects for Percussionists
1. Stick technique / Drum set
• technique, independence and coordination
• basics in the different styles
• reading / interpretation / improvisation
2. Percussion lessons
Main styles:
• Afro – Cuban
• Brazil
• African
• Fusion
Main groups of instruments :
• Congas
• Djembe
• Timbales
• small percussion intruments
